如何在启动Spark History Server时指定Spark属性?

时间:2016-01-21 05:28:55

标签: apache-spark

有没有人知道如何在启动Spark History Server时在<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js"></script> <div id="home-img-blocks"> <div data-content="FIND OUT MORE" class="home-img-block"> <img src="http://optimumwebdesigns.com/images/test1.jpg"> <div class="overlay"></div> </div> <div data-content="FIND OUT" class="home-img-block"> <img src="http://optimumwebdesigns.com/images/test2.jpg"> <div class="overlay"></div> </div> <div data-content="FIND" class="home-img-block"> <img src="http://optimumwebdesigns.com/images/test3.jpg"> <div class="overlay"></div> </div> </div>中设置值?

2 个答案:

答案 0 :(得分:4)

如果使用<SPARK_HOME>/sbin/start-history-server.sh,则无法指定命令行参数,但可以将SPARK_HISTORY_OPTS指定为环境变量,并指定各种环境变量,如: -

export SPARK_HISTORY_OPTS="$SPARK_HISTORY_OPTS -Dspark.history.ui.port=9000

但如果您使用的是<SPARK_HOME>/sbin/start-daemon.sh脚本,则可以指定多个命令行选项。像这样: -

<SPARK_HOME>/sbin/spark-daemon.sh start org.apache.spark.deploy.history.HistoryServer -Dspark.history.ui.port=9000

答案 1 :(得分:2)

start-history-server.sh接受--properties-file [propertiesFile]命令行选项,使用propertiesFile指定自定义Spark属性。

如果未明确指定,Spark History Server将使用默认配置文件,即conf/spark-defaults.conf